Crochet + Knitting for Geeks

Verena Kuni Ha3k3ln + Str1ck3n fuer Geeks

By the way, did I mention already that my pattern generators (maze pattern generator, cellular automaton and random squares pattern generator) have been mentioned in a book? :))

I’ve read it and I also had fun with the rest of the book ;-)
I liked especially the (here already presented ;-)) crocheted hyperbolic planes and freeform work, knit-covered (computer)cords (similar to filled i-cord), yarn bombing and the secure password input, but also mobius shawls, klein bottle hats, hacked knitting machines and much more.

The Little Yellow Duck Project

The Little Yellow Duck Project

The Little Yellow Duck Project is meant to point out to people in a kind way how important it is to donate blood, tissue, bone marrow or organs.
You can simply make a little yellow duck, give it a tag with it’s name and purpose and leave it in public places for others to find.

Instructions for sewn, knitted and crocheted little ducks can be found on the website, as well as tags to print.

And if you find a little duck, you can tell them at The Little Yellow Duck Project so that everybody knows where the little ones have been found already :)
